____________________ are body waves that can travel through air, liquid, and solid material.

Answer:

compressional or primary waves

Explanation:

Compressional or primary body waves are body waves that can travel through air, liquid, and solid material. They are body waves that travels through the interior of a body e.g Earth's inner layer. The primary body wave is the fastest to arrive at a location and eventually compresses and expands material in the same direction it travels.
